Reverse Osmosis Installation in Austin, TX
Reverse osmosis installation services provide homeowners with a reliable way to improve the quality of their drinking water. This process involves setting up a filtration system that uses a semi-permeable membrane to remove impurities, contaminants, and unwanted substances from tap water. Projects typically include installing systems under sinks, in basements, or integrating whole-house units, making it suitable for various property sizes and water quality needs. Property owners often want to understand the system’s capacity, maintenance requirements, and how it can effectively reduce common contaminants like chlorine, sediment, and certain minerals.
Before requesting reverse osmosis installation, property owners should consider the current water quality and any specific concerns about taste, odor, or safety. It’s helpful to evaluate the space available for the system, understand the ongoing maintenance involved, and determine whether a point-of-use or whole-house solution best meets their needs. Clarifying these details ensures the chosen system aligns with household water usage and quality expectations, providing a clear pathway toward cleaner, better-tasting water.

Reverse Osmosis Installation Questions
What is reverse osmosis water treatment? Reverse osmosis is a filtration process that removes impurities and contaminants from water by forcing it through a semi-permeable membrane, resulting in clean drinking water.
What types of properties typically need reverse osmosis installation? Residential homes, especially those with well water or concerns about water quality, often benefit from reverse osmosis systems.
How does the installation process work? The system is connected to the existing water supply, usually under the sink or in the basement, and includes filters and a membrane to purify water before use.
What should property owners consider before installing a reverse osmosis system? It's important to evaluate water quality, available space, and the system's capacity to ensure it meets household needs.
